Yes, the word 'bones', the plural form of 'bone', is a common noun, a general word for any bones of any kind.

A proper noun is the name of a specific person, place, or thing; for example:

  • Bones Road, Sebastopol, CA or Bones Road, Byesville, OH
  • Smokey Bones Bar & Fire Grill, Colonie, NY
  • "Bones: A Forensic Detective's Casebook" by Dr. Douglas Ubelaker & Henry Scammell
  • "Bones", American TV series
